Hi everybody
I just would like to tell you short about me. I collected minerals when I was a young boy. Then my hobby went down for a little while. When me and my wife got kids I discovered photography as a new hobby. I then also discovered my old hobby minerals again when I started taking photos of my collection. Due to the fact that we have kids now time and budget is limited for my hobby.
Some more quick infos.
Focus: Famous localities from all over the world in the size range from thumbnail to cabinet. Due to the limited budget of course most of the time in the smaller categories.
I now would like to show you some of the pieces from my collection and I am open for tips and things I can do better. On collecting minerals as well as photography.
So far. Let me know if you have any questions.
I will start with one of my favourites. It is an Epidote from the Söllnkar. That is a spot located two valleys next to the Knappenwand.

Here is another very interesting piece I found on my own. It is Titanite (var. Sphene) on Calcite with a small Epidote and Byssolith. According to the locals this combination is quite rare. The overall size of the piece is about 6cm.
